Spend an amazing day exploring the beauty of Sian Ka'an (A Mayan phrase for "where the sky is born"). This paradise was the first established Biosphere Reserve in Mexico. It is currently a UNESCO World Heritage site and its protection remains a high priority for Mexico. The Reserve is home of 800 different plant species and provides a habitat for 350 species of birds, as well as jaguar, puma, ocelot, spider and howler monkeys, crocodiles and many types of turtles.
